Description

Turner & Townsend  is a global professional services company with over 22,000 people in more than 60 countries. Working with our clients across real estate, infrastructure, energy and natural resources, we transform together delivering outcomes that improve people’s lives. Working in partnership makes it possible to deliver the world’s most impactful projects and programmes as we turn challenge into opportunity and complexity into success. Our capabilities include programme, project, cost, asset and commercial management, controls and performance, procurement and supply chain, net zero and digital solutions. We are majority-owned by CBRE Group, Inc., the world’s largest commercial real estate services and investment firm, with our partners holding a significant minority interest. Turner & Townsend and CBRE work together to provide clients with the premier programme, project and cost management offering in markets around the world. Turner & Townsend is seeking an inspiring and innovative leader to serve as Director, Procurement & Supply Chain Lead . This role offers a unique opportunity to shape the future of our Procurement & Supply Chain Advisory services, drive strategic growth, and deliver market-leading solutions across major real estate and infrastructure programs. The successful candidate will lead a high-performing team, develop new service offerings, and foster innovation to ensure our capabilities remain ahead of evolving market demands. Travel will be required to support client engagements and team collaboration across regions. Role and Responsibilities The Director will be accountable for advancing our procurement and supply chain strategy for construction projects, delivering high-impact client engagements, and driving business performance. This includes leading major projects and programs, developing digital and data-driven solutions, and building trusted relationships with senior stakeholders. The role requires a strong focus on revenue growth, client satisfaction, and team development. Key responsibilities include: • Leading the development and delivery of differentiated procurement and supply chain solutions that generate tangible client benefits • Driving strategic growth through market expansion, client engagement, and positioning Turner & Townsend as a leader in digital procurement and supply chain advisory • Overseeing the delivery of complex, high-value construction programs across multiple sectors, ensuring excellence in execution and client satisfaction • Developing and owning market strategy to strengthen brand visibility and expand service penetration across key sectors • Building and maintaining executive-level client relationships, identifying opportunities, and proposing innovative solutions aligned with client needs • Leading bid preparation, proposal development, and commercial negotiations to secure high-margin, impactful construction projects • Advancing digital capabilities and integrating technology and data to optimize procurement and supply chain outcomes • Managing team performance, setting objectives, and ensuring the team possesses the insights, skills, and resources to meet business goals • Establishing key performance targets and financial budgets, optimizing business performance in alignment with strategic objectives • Supporting the development of procurement services, including strategic sourcing, contract management, supplier evaluation, and supply chain intelligence • Leading and mentoring a team of specialist consultants, fostering a collaborative and high-performance culture • Contributing to the leadership of the business by supporting talent development, knowledge sharing, and continuous improvement • Minimum of ten years of experience in procurement and supply chain leadership, • Bachelor’s degree or higher in business, supply chain management, engineering, construction, or a related field • Recognized expertise in strategic procurement across public and private sectors, with experience in major capital programs • Strong consulting background with experience managing client relationships at senior and executive levels • Demonstrated success in leading high-value projects and navigating complex stakeholder environments • Deep understanding of contract development, supplier evaluation, commercial modeling, and negotiation strategies • Experience across multiple sectors, with domain knowledge in real estate, infrastructure, or related industries preferred • Proven ability to influence client behaviors and decisions, particularly in high-risk, high-value engagements Skills and Behavioral Attributes • Strategic thinker with outstanding project management and analytical capabilities • Strong business judgment, critical thinking, and value-based decision-making •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ate across geographies and organizational levels • Proficiency in supplier intelligence, relationship management, and commercial strategy • Ability to lead teams, manage performance, and support career development • High level of initiative, adaptability, and attention to detail • Confident, independent, and trustworthy with a proactive approach to problem solving • Collaborative and empathetic leadership style with a commitment to fairness, consistency, and team development • Resilient and adaptable in dynamic, fast-paced environments with the ability to navigate complexity and ambiguity *On-site presence and requirements may change depending on our clients' needs.* Our inspired people share our vision and mission.
